Summary

Dr. Paul Atkinson specializes in neurology, bringing 23 years of experience to treating disorders of the nervous system. They earned their medical degree from the University of Wisconsin School of Medicine & Public Health. Dr. Atkinson is fluent in English.

Dr. Atkinson practices with Monument Health Neurology and Rehabilitation in Rapid City, South Dakota, and maintains an affiliation with Phillips Eye Institute. They focus on treating seizure conditions, including epilepsy and focal seizures. Their expertise includes performing electroencephalograms to monitor brain activity and ordering comprehensive metabolic panels and complete blood counts to support patient care.
